[4]: TKY-BL (YAYOI Bi+Li column)   Experimental system
Filter: Fe(160mm), C(100mm), PE(15mm), Bi(100mm), Li(5mm). E(ave)=0.210 MeV, Gamma contamination (E=1.401 MeV)=47.8 % at Gy level
Materials: Human peripheral blood (whole blood irradiation): Irradiation at 150mm apart from the filter surface.
Date: 1992.06.20.
